Cain, Hamilton, Ozuna, and Lagares are actually debatable. Hell, they all had more fWAR than EAton. Myers might be as well given his potential. But if you were to base this on last year's body of work, then Eaton should be top 10.

I could be convinced to take any of those 10 guys over Eaton. While it's debatable, I don't think it's crazy to not have him on there.

He could definitely fit on that list but "1 injury-shortened successful season" isn't a track record that stands out unless you've done something ridiculous in the minors like Hamilton. Give us 150 games doing that next year and he's perhaps top 5-6.
